Output 660a78b1356e35a17f86e7aecd966432371e5ed539aab478de673c60e8ac40f4:0

value
1693808
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e340b21f2ebbdfdb60d7259e5878b3a57da98c27 OP_EQUALVERIFY OP_CHECKSIG
address
1MibtgtN1zVRkmWJYAguV1JskSQ8wkVUfZ
transaction
660a78b1356e35a17f86e7aecd966432371e5ed539aab478de673c60e8ac40f4
confirmations
431087
spent
true